We will be trialling new arrangements for exiting at the end of the day. From Tuesday 27th September families may exit the building through both the school gate and reception. However we ask that parents enter the school at both the start and end of the day through the school gate. This will prevent congestion in the reception area. We want to ensure that movement around the school is safe.

Punctuality We have had a high number of pupils arriving late for school. School starts at 8.50am, it is important that children do not miss out on learning at the start of the day. If children are late they must sign in at the entrance to the school and then enter through the small hall. This ensures that children are registered since class registers may have closed.
